Acoustic Signal

The acoustic signal sounds:
Upon the appearance of a disturbance in 2 second intervals.
After completion of a centrifugation run and rotor standstill in 30 second intervals.
The acoustic signal is stopped by opening the lid or pressing any key.

Relative centrifugal force (RCF)

The relative centrifugal force (RCF) is given as a multiple of the acceleration of gravity (g). It is a unit-free value and
serves to compare the separation and sedimentation performance.

Centrifugation of materials with higher density

The rotors are designed to centrifuge substances up to a maximum mean homogenous density of 1.2 kg/dm
rotating at the stated speed.
Denser substances must be centrifuged at lower speed.
The permissible speed can be calculated using the following formula:
